Job Description
- To lead the Real Estate Development and Project Management function on capital projects within South Africa and African Regions towards the successful delivery across the full project life cycle, from an effective decision-making perspective in terms of project and portfolio planning, financing, initiation, resourcing, execution, governance, risk monitoring, and integrated control through to completion and finally handover. We are looking for you to lead complex projects, manage internal and external stakeholders, have a commercial focus and balance working across major projects.
Qualifications
- A recognized Degree qualification relating to a technical field: Engineering, Construction Management, Quantity Surveying, Architecture or similar. A further qualification in Project management would be an added advantage .
Experience:
- More than 10 years Construction Project Management experience is preferable.
- Proven end to end project management skills from concept through to completion.
- Contract administration experience.
- Exposure to program management, managing timelines and critical paths.
- Experience in running multiple projects
- Technical ability to lead and manage complex projects and programs as the key client interface
- Excellent command of written and spoken English with excellent report and bid writing skills.
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to lead and develop a team.
- Microsoft Package (Outlook, Excel, Power Point and Word, MS Project), knowledge of share drive.
Additional Information
Key Responsibilities:
- Ensure that the project team is established and is fit for purpose, in order to adequately deliver the project.
- Coordinate the whole project team and serve as a key link with the Head of REDPM and client’s representative and review the deliverable prepared by the team before passing onto the client.
- Manage and develop team spirit and ensure that staff involved in the project are committed to the same goal Identify and negotiate assignment of resources.
- Control project in respect of cost, time and quality Implement and ensure control measures for cost, time and quality are in place.
- Facilitate and ensure that all activities follow the predetermined schedule and critically
- monitor project milestones.
- Conduct regular status meetings with the Project Management team.
- Conduct periodic inspection visits to project site(s).
